Log:
Fix top-level targets with read-only OBJDIR.
This also makes it so that top-level build targets do not immediately create
the OBJDIR. Only sub-make targets will do so. This avoids creating object
directories for targets like 'make check-old' or creating unneeded
MACHINE.MACHINE_ARCH directories during 'make tinderbox'.
